As a Broadband Technician II
, you will perform intermediate to complex installations, disconnects and service changes for residential customers, including FTTH (Fiber to the Home RFoG and GPON). These services include, but are not limited to, video service, HSD Services, and home phone service. This role performs moderate troubleshooting from the tap to the customer's electronic devices (TV, DVD, Modem etc.). This role performs underground and/or aerial construction involved with system plant, along with its’ repair and maintenance supporting various customer-focused activities.
This position will be responsible for installing, splicing, repairing and maintaining aerial, buried, and/or underground fiber optic and coax cable. This position will need to be knowledgeable of commonly used concepts, practices, and procedures within the field of telecommunications.

Responsibilities- Performs intermediate and complex installation of all necessary cable wiring (interior and exterior) and hardware from the tap/MST to the customer’s equipment for reception of cable and other company services that are offered for single, multi-family customers and/or commercial dwellings over both Fiber Optic and Coax delivery methods. Position may be responsible for inspection and correction of NESC safety violations for new construction builds and new service drops and legacy facilities.
Position may be responsible for the coordination of underground drop burial work with contractor and in-house underground burial crews, filling out, submitting and pickup up permits from government agencies as required to perform work in the ROW, tracking and updating status within the systems. Duties also include inspections ensuring that work performed meets all construction and government standards and pre-inspection verifies of serviceability of new customers in regards to finding the best, most efficient and cost effective routes to provide service. - Performs connects (new connects and reconnects), disconnects, upgrades, downgrades, relocates, install additional outlets, fiber connections, and hardline cutovers; installs or removes equipment (i.e. converters) at single or multiple unit dwellings.
- Utilizes test equipment to identify and repair signal strength issues and ensure optimum reception both optical and RF
